1 | {
|
2 | "type": "module",
|
3 | "name": "open-props",
|
4 | "author": "Adam Argyle",
|
5 | "license": "MIT",
|
6 | "version": "1.1.1",
|
7 | "repository": {
|
8 | "type": "git",
|
9 | "url": "https://github.com/argyleink/open-props"
|
10 | },
|
11 | "keywords": [
|
12 | "css",
|
13 | "utilities",
|
14 | "variables",
|
15 | "custom properties",
|
16 | "gradients"
|
17 | ],
|
18 | "style": "open-props.min.css",
|
19 | "source": "src/index.js",
|
20 | "main": "dist/open-props.cjs",
|
21 | "unpkg": "open-props.min.css",
|
22 | "module": "dist/open-props.module.js",
|
23 | "exports": {
|
24 | ".": {
|
25 | "import": "./dist/open-props.module.js",
|
26 | "require": "./dist/open-props.cjs",
|
27 | "default": "./dist/open-props.cjs"
|
28 | },
|
29 | "./style": "./open-props.min.css",
|
30 | "./postcss/style": "./src/index.css",
|
31 | "./normalize": "./normalize.min.css",
|
32 | "./postcss/normalize": "./src/extra/normalize.css",
|
33 | "./animations": "./animations.min.css",
|
34 | "./aspects": "./aspects.min.css",
|
35 | "./blue": "./blue.min.css",
|
36 | "./borders": "./borders.min.css",
|
37 | "./colors": "./colors.min.css",
|
38 | "./cyan": "./cyan.min.css",
|
39 | "./easings": "./easings.min.css",
|
40 | "./fonts": "./fonts.min.css",
|
41 | "./gradients": "./gradients.min.css",
|
42 | "./grape": "./grape.min.css",
|
43 | "./gray": "./gray.min.css",
|
44 | "./green": "./green.min.css",
|
45 | "./indigo": "./indigo.min.css",
|
46 | "./lime": "./lime.min.css",
|
47 | "./media": "./media.min.css",
|
48 | "./orange": "./orange.min.css",
|
49 | "./pink": "./pink.min.css",
|
50 | "./red": "./red.min.css",
|
51 | "./shadows": "./shadows.min.css",
|
52 | "./sizes": "./sizes.min.css",
|
53 | "./teal": "./teal.min.css",
|
54 | "./violet": "./violet.min.css",
|
55 | "./yellow": "./yellow.min.css",
|
56 | "./zindex": "./zindex.min.css",
|
57 | "./json": "./open-props.tokens.json",
|
58 | "./tokens": "./open-props.tokens.json",
|
59 | "./design-tokens": "./open-props.tokens.json"
|
60 | },
|
61 | "browserslist": [
|
62 | "defaults"
|
63 | ],
|
64 | "scripts": {
|
65 | "build": "npm run gen:op",
|
66 | "test": "ava test/basic.test.cjs",
|
67 | "bundle": "concurrently npm:lib:*",
|
68 | "bundle:pre-edit": "json -I -f package.json -e \"this.unpkg=''\"",
|
69 | "bundle:post-edit": "json -I -f package.json -e \"this.unpkg='open-props.min.css'\"",
|
70 | "gen:op": "cd src && node _create-props.js '' true",
|
71 | "gen:nowhere": "cd src && node _create-props.js '' false",
|
72 | "gen:prefixed": "cd src && node _create-props.js 'op'",
|
73 | "lib:js": "npm run bundle:pre-edit && microbundle --no-sourcemap && npm run bundle:post-edit",
|
74 | "lib:all": "postcss src/index.css -o open-props.min.css",
|
75 | "lib:normalize": "postcss src/extra/normalize.css -o normalize.min.css",
|
76 | "lib:animations": "postcss src/props.animations.css -o animations.min.css",
|
77 | "lib:aspects": "postcss src/props.aspects.css -o aspects.min.css",
|
78 | "lib:borders": "postcss src/props.borders.css -o borders.min.css",
|
79 | "lib:easing": "postcss src/props.easing.css -o easings.min.css",
|
80 | "lib:fonts": "postcss src/props.fonts.css -o fonts.min.css",
|
81 | "lib:gradients": "postcss src/props.gradients.css -o gradients.min.css",
|
82 | "lib:media": "postcss src/props.media.css -o media.min.css",
|
83 | "lib:shadows": "postcss src/props.shadows.css -o shadows.min.css",
|
84 | "lib:sizes": "postcss src/props.sizes.css -o sizes.min.css",
|
85 | "lib:supports": "postcss src/props.supports.css -o supports.min.css",
|
86 | "lib:zindex": "postcss src/props.zindex.css -o zindex.min.css",
|
87 | "lib:colors": "postcss src/props.colors.css -o colors.min.css",
|
88 | "lib:colors:gray": "postcss src/props.gray.css -o gray.min.css",
|
89 | "lib:colors:red": "postcss src/props.red.css -o red.min.css",
|
90 | "lib:colors:pink": "postcss src/props.pink.css -o pink.min.css",
|
91 | "lib:colors:grape": "postcss src/props.grape.css -o grape.min.css",
|
92 | "lib:colors:violet": "postcss src/props.violet.css -o violet.min.css",
|
93 | "lib:colors:indigo": "postcss src/props.indigo.css -o indigo.min.css",
|
94 | "lib:colors:blue": "postcss src/props.blue.css -o blue.min.css",
|
95 | "lib:colors:cyan": "postcss src/props.cyan.css -o cyan.min.css",
|
96 | "lib:colors:teal": "postcss src/props.teal.css -o teal.min.css",
|
97 | "lib:colors:green": "postcss src/props.green.css -o green.min.css",
|
98 | "lib:colors:lime": "postcss src/props.lime.css -o lime.min.css",
|
99 | "lib:colors:yellow": "postcss src/props.yellow.css -o yellow.min.css",
|
100 | "lib:colors:orange": "postcss src/props.orange.css -o orange.min.css"
|
101 | },
|
102 | "devDependencies": {
|
103 | "ava": "^3.15.0",
|
104 | "concurrently": "^6.2.1",
|
105 | "cssnano": "^5.0.8",
|
106 | "json": "^11.0.0",
|
107 | "microbundle": "^0.13.3",
|
108 | "open-color": "^1.9.1",
|
109 | "postcss": "^8.3.9",
|
110 | "postcss-cli": "^8.3.1",
|
111 | "postcss-combine-duplicated-selectors": "^10.0.3",
|
112 | "postcss-import": "^14.0.2",
|
113 | "postcss-preset-env": "6.7.x"
|
114 | }
|
115 | }
|